About The Confluence Historic Site & Parkland
The confluence of the Bow and Elbow Rivers has been a place of significance to Indigenous peoples long before 1875, when the North-West Mounted Police established a site of colonial occupation called Fort Calgary and prepared the way for a new settler-colonial community. This place remains significant to Indigenous peoples today, and The Confluence Historic Site & Parkland now strives to provide the space and opportunity to reflect on the past and help create better paths for our future.
